This hiking route is set in the beautiful area of Via Valsabbia, offering stunning views and a moderate level of difficulty. The trail covers a distance of 6.851 kilometers with an elevation gain of 213 meters, taking approximately 2 hours and 7 minutes to complete.
As you start your journey, you will come across various points of interest along the way. At the beginning of the trail, you will encounter the ruins of Cascina Novegno, a historic site located just 0.94 kilometers from the start. Further along, at 0.81 kilometers, you'll find the Santella della Guardia wayside shrine and at 0.92 kilometers, a lovely picnic site.
Midway through the hike, at 1.95 kilometers, there is a drinking water facility for you to replenish your supply. As you continue, you will reach the Passo del Cavallo at 1.94 kilometers, a natural saddle providing a picturesque vista. The trail also includes picnic sites, parking areas, and informative signposts to enhance your hiking experience.
It is recommended to bring an ample water supply, wear sturdy hiking shoes, and check the weather forecast before embarking on this journey. Additionally, be prepared for some rocky terrain and varying elevations along the way.
